For investors seeking durable, high-quality growth, TME's improving capital efficiency, robust earnings momentum, and expanding monetization avenues present a compelling case.Return on capital employed (ROCE) is a critical metric for assessing how effectively a company generates profits from its invested capital. Tencent Music's ROCE has surged from 8.78% in December 2023 to 13% as of June 2025, far outpacing the 9.0% industry average. This trajectory reflects a company that is not only allocating capital wisely but also reinvesting returns into high-margin initiatives.
The improvement in ROCE is underpinned by TME's focus on high-return areas such as content development, AI-driven product innovation, and global expansion. For instance, the company's investment in premium subscriptions (SVIP) and live entertainment has yielded outsized returns. By prioritizing initiatives that enhance user engagement and monetization—such as exclusive artist content and AI-enhanced audio experiences—TME has transformed its capital base into a self-reinforcing engine of growth.
TME's financial performance in Q2 2025 underscores its ability to scale profitably. Total revenue reached RMB8.44 billion (US$1.18 billion), a 17.9% year-over-year increase, driven by a 26.4% surge in online music services revenue to RMB6.85 billion. Within this segment, music subscription revenue grew 17.1% to RMB4.38 billion, propelled by a 9.3% rise in average revenue per paying user (ARPPU) to RMB11.7. The expansion of the SVIP program, which offers premium benefits like early concert access and exclusive merchandise, has been pivotal in driving this growth.
Live entertainment has also become a significant revenue driver. TME's strategic hosting of high-profile concerts—such as G-DRAGON's international tour in Macau and Fiona Sit's stadium events—has not only boosted ticket and merchandise sales but also enhanced brand loyalty. In the first half of 2025 alone, the company facilitated over 300 offline performances for artists on its Tencent Musician Platform, leveraging proprietary IPs like CITY LIVE and BUFF LIVE to create a sticky ecosystem.
TME's reinvestment strategy is a masterclass in balancing short-term profitability with long-term value creation. The company has allocated capital to three key areas:
Content Ecosystem Expansion: Partnerships with global labels (e.g., SM Entertainment, The Black Label) and co-productions like NCT CHENLE's Chinese EP Lucid have enriched TME's content library, particularly in K-pop and cross-border genres. These collaborations not only attract new users but also deepen engagement with existing ones.
AI and Product Innovation: Investments in AI-driven features—such as Kugou Music's VIPER HiFi sound quality and the AI Chorus function—have redefined user experiences. These innovations are not just incremental improvements; they are strategic differentiators that justify premium pricing and enhance retention.
Global and Cross-Industry Expansion: TME's foray into international markets and partnerships with car manufacturers to enhance in-car music experiences exemplify its ambition to diversify revenue streams. The company's R&D spending, coupled with a strong balance sheet (RMB34.92 billion in cash as of June 2025), provides the flexibility to pursue bold initiatives without overleveraging.
TME's ability to compound growth stems from its virtuous cycle: rising ROCE enables reinvestment in high-margin initiatives, which in turn drive earnings growth and further improve capital efficiency. This self-reinforcing dynamic is rare in the entertainment sector, where many companies struggle with stagnant returns or declining margins.
For example, TME's gross margin expanded to 44.4% in Q2 2025 from 42.0% in the same period of 2024, despite rising IP-related costs. This margin improvement, combined with a 37.4% year-over-year increase in non-IFRS net profit to RMB2.57 billion, highlights the company's operational discipline.
